The Opportunity

We are seeking a talented and motivated Sr. Scientist with an extensive knowledge of therapeutic protein formulation strategies and potential protein degradation mechanisms, including experience developing high concentration protein formulations.  The candidate must have a strong knowledge of protein biochemistry & biophysics; familiarity with biologic drug product characterization & control strategies; and experience developing drug product manufacturing processes including lyophilization and/or combination products.  The candidate will join a broader process development group with opportunities to closely collaborate on all aspects of analytical, formulation, and process development across a broad range of novel large molecules including oligonucleotide-protein conjugates and knob-in-hole Fc-fusion proteins.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Independently drive formulation and drug product development activities for one or more of Denali’s large molecule biotherapeutics including:
    • Developing an understanding of key mechanisms of degradation for each potential therapeutic
    • Designing and executing appropriate formulation development studies to identify clinical and commercial formulation & dosage form, establish in-use compatibility, and support comparability
    • Oversee drug product process development activities
    • Develop stress comparability strategies to support process changes and scale-up
  • Hands-on biophysical and biochemical characterization of protein therapeutics in the laboratory using chromatography-, capillary-, spectroscopy-based analytical methods with a focus on evaluating product stability, compatibility, and comparability.
  • Translate understanding of critical quality attributes (CQA) and key mechanisms of degradation into robust, stable formulations and dosage forms that ensure product quality and efficacy
  • Perform rigorous risk assessments of the impact of drug product manufacturing and storage conditions on product quality
  • Author technical documents including formulation development reports, ICH-compliant stability protocols, and relevant sections of regulatory filings to support external QC partners and regulatory submissions.
  • Oversee formulation and drug product manufacturing activities at external contract manufacturing organizations (CMO) including review of stability protocols, DP process development studies, tech transfer activities, review of drug product analytical control system specifications and DP-specific analytical method transfer and qualification protocols/reports.
  • Lead troubleshooting activities and serve as subject matter expert (SME) for Quality investigations at CMOs
  • Participate and be actively engaged in cross-functional technical decision-making including collaborating with Discovery Biotherapeutics, Bioprocess Development, Analytical Development and Quality
  • Contribute to establishing internal state-of-the-art formulation capabilities to support accelerated CMC development
